Volleyball Defeats Columbia in Three Sets

Gainesville, Georgia- The Brenau volleyball team defeated Columbia (SC) College in three sets in an Appalachian Athletic Conference matchup on Tuesday.

The Golden Tigers rolled through three sets (25-20, 25-20, 25-20) as junior Ashlyn Browning led the attack with 14 kills and a blistering .440 hitting percentage. Junior Malone Davis added 8 kills and 4 digs, while sophomore setter Nathalia Quintero posted 23 assists.

Defensively, junior libero Dallas Morse had 19 digs, while sophomore Jomaris Maldonado had seven digs. 

Columbia's Destiny Brown led the visitors with 9 kills. 

Brenau (4-6 overall, 2-3 AAC) next faces non-conference opponent Spartanburg Methodist (10-10 overall) on Friday at 6:30 pm.
